Job Responsibilities

COMPENSATION: $27.86/Hour

GENERAL

  • Operates various machines involved in the assembly and testing of parts by inspecting and inserting appropriate pieces, activating machine, receiving and inspecting assembled parts and placing it in the appropriate bin or box
  • May rotate and operate all machines in assembly
  • May be required to hand assemble pieces or compacting pieces as required
  • Interact with Quality Group, as necessary, to understand the acceptable level of part quality
  • Implement and drive MPS activities and initiatives
  • Uphold 5S standard for continuous improvement
  • Set‑up, adjust; maintain assembly equipment, changeover equipment and machinery to required schedules
  • Ensure housekeeping and safety standards are maintained at all times
  • Performs Total Preventative Maintenance (TPM), activities as per TPM check sheet (Line Specific)
  • Support Maintenance department as required
  • Adhere to Line Cycle Time
  • Performs general maintenance on equipment
  • Review and sign all communications at beginning of shift (i.e. Log Books, Quality Alerts, etc.)
  • Completes all documentation and records as it relates to the set‑up function
  • Must be aware of relevance/importance of their activities - how it affects quality/environment for our Customers
  • Performs other duties as required

Qualifications

EDUCATION:

  • Grade 12 Diploma or equivalent required
Knowledge, Skills, & Abilities
  • Proven track record for performance and attendance in current position required;
  • Formal Lockout/Tagout training required;
  • 1‑3 years of related work experience
  • Valid Driver's license and ability to travel between plants required;
  • Prior work experience in an automotive manufacturing environment or equivalent an asset;
  • Comprehend the three main control factors of production plant: NG (no good parts), DT (downtime) and CT (cycle time);
Working Conditions
  • Ability to work flexible hours and willing to work overtime, as required;
  • Ability to bend, twist, lift, reach;
  • Ability to lift max. 50lbs periodically;
  • Ability to stand, walk, climb, kneel on a regular basis;
  • Ability to work at a computer workstation (sitting or standing);
  • Ability to work in areas that may have slippery conditions;
  • Required to carry out job duties and responsibilities in a work environment that may include, but is not limited to, varying levels of noise and/or temperature;
  • This is an onsite position;
